Key Ceremony Checklist — Item 7 (Cartonix Webhook)

Generate the new signing keypair for the parcel-tracking webhook on the air-gapped laptop. Two witnesses required. Export the public half only; private half stays in the sealed enclave. Verify fingerprint matches the ceremony sheet. Then seal the enclave backup. The sealing tool prompts once for the ceremony recovery passphrase, which must be entered exactly as follows.

unlock words, hahip-baduf: holwyn-istath-julvan

# Build Provenance: LedgerSpin Blue-Green Deploys

Reviewers: every LedgerSpin billing-worker deploy runs blue-green. The green slice receives the candidate build, processes shadow invoices for 30 minutes, and is promoted only if reconciliation deltas are zero. Provenance is enforced at promotion: the artifact's signed attestation must match the approved merge commit, or the swap aborts. When approving a deploy PR, confirm the attestation digest matches what CI recorded. The token for the current green build appears below.

trace token, fafof-tajef: htk9_849b0fd88

## Local Setup

Welcome to InkPress, our PDF invoice renderer! Getting it running is pretty painless: install the deps with `make setup`, grab the font bundle via `make fonts`, and run `make preview` to render a sample invoice. The renderer pulls invoice line items and customer layouts from a local dev database. Point your environment at it using the connection string below.

replica DSN, kajep-yahag: mssql://praok_svc:iF@db-8d68.plorvaio.local:5432/eliion

**Key Ceremony Checklist — Item 9 (Bounce Processor)**

For the weekly eng sync: before rotating the DKIM keys, pause the Fernpost bounce processor so it doesn't misclassify signature failures as hard bounces during the swap. Confirm the processor's retry queue is under 500 entries and that suppression-list writes are frozen. Two ceremony witnesses must initial the log sheet once the pause is verified. After the pause is confirmed and logged, unlock the key material archive using the recovery passphrase recorded directly below.

unlock words, tawif-tahop: oliys-ulawyn-tamdor-lamys-casox-jormir-fraius-kasath-ulador-ulamir-holir-sorys-holeth